Fredonia Man Charged with DWAI-Drugs Following Traffic Stop on Main Street

(WNY News Now) – FREDONIA, N.Y. — A traffic stop for speeding early Friday morning in the Village of Fredonia led to the arrest of a local man on drug-related driving charges, according to the Chautauqua County Sheriff’s Office.

Deputies reported that at approximately 12:50 a.m. on March 20, 2026, a vehicle was stopped on Main Street after it was observed traveling above the posted speed limit.

The driver was identified as 39-year-old Frank G. Rivera-Montero of Fredonia. Following an investigation, deputies determined that Rivera-Montero was operating the vehicle while his ability was impaired by drugs…
